The Seasonal Influence on Customer Choices

Spring: Renewal and Fresh Starts
As nature awakens, customers feel renewed energy and excitement for the coming season. They are drawn to fresh produce, gardening supplies, and artisanal goods that celebrate the season’s bounty.

Bright colours and fragrant blooms attract attention, while health-conscious shoppers seek out organic options and spring-inspired treats.

Summer: Abundance and Outdoor Living
Longer days bring an abundance of vibrant fruits, vegetables, and herbs to market stalls. Customers crave refreshing beverages, handmade ice creams, and artisanal cheeses for picnics and barbecues.

Stall holders can capitalise on the outdoor lifestyle by offering convenient, portable snacks and unique entertainment options like live music or cooking demonstrations.

Fall: Harvest and Coziness
The harvest season brings a cornucopia of pumpkins, apples, and hearty vegetables. Customers are eager for warm beverages, seasonal decor, and comfort foods like freshly baked pies and that mouth-watering smell of fresh baked bread.

Stall holders can create cosy atmospheres with displays which are rustic and autumnal. Try offering seasonal promotions which highlight the flavours and traditions of autumn.

Winter: Festivity and Warmth
As temperatures drop, customers seek out festive decorations, gourmet treats, and gifts for loved ones. Warm beverages, handmade crafts, and indulgent sweets appeal to shoppers looking to celebrate holidays and create memorable experiences.

Stall holders can enhance the winter market experience with holiday-themed decorations, seasonal gift baskets, and personalised customer interactions. Make it warm and intimate for the marketplace visitor.

Three Effective Strategies to Capitalise on Seasonal Changes

1. Seasonal Promotions and Special Events

  • Idea: Host seasonal-themed events such as apple cider tastings in the fall or flower arranging workshops in spring to attract customers.
  • Low-Cost Solution: Partner with local musicians or artisans to offer live entertainment or demonstrations that complement your products without additional cost.

2. Product Diversification and Bundling

  • Idea: Bundle seasonal items like a picnic basket set with summer fruits or a baking kit with winter spices to encourage larger purchases.
  • Low-Cost Solution: Create attractive, themed displays using inexpensive props like seasonal decorations or repurposed materials to enhance product presentation.

3. Personalised Customer Engagement

  • Idea: Offer personalised recommendations based on seasonal preferences or host loyalty programs that reward repeat customers with exclusive discounts or free samples.
  • Low-Cost Solution: Use social media platforms and email newsletters to communicate directly with customers about upcoming seasonal offerings and promotions, fostering a sense of anticipation and exclusivity.

Driving Customer Loyalty with Low-Cost Solutions

1. Social Media Engagement

  • Utilise platforms like Instagram and Facebook to showcase seasonal products, share behind-the-scenes stories, and engage with customers through polls or contests.

2. Customer Appreciation Days

  • Dedicate a day each season to offer special discounts, free tastings, or loyalty rewards to show appreciation for regular customers and attract new ones.

3. Creative Signage and Displays

  • Use colourful signage, chalkboards, or handmade banners to highlight seasonal offerings and create an inviting atmosphere that draws customers in.
